I wont be changing my driver for a while.&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How do you like your GT driver?</title><link>https://www.titleist.in.th/teamtitleist/thread/363334?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Thu, 05 Jun 2025 18:30:45 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">9ab519fc-5311-4952-85cd-0a0ceffb73fb:52002bba-6509-437e-b9f0-335b37253260</guid><dc:creator>Don O</dc:creator><description>With some injuries and age-related decline I knew my TSR -2 was not setup for the current me this year. I was fit for in August 2022. Long story short, I elected to go to the 2nd Swing store in Minneapolis.  I put my trust in the hands of Jacob to see if there would be a better option. He was thorough in getting an assessment and working through what was going on with the TSR. &lt;br /&gt;
As I expected, we ended up with a GT-1 12 degree. Without a change in ball speed, a comparison of both drivers outdoor I gained 12 yards and increased launch from 9 to 13 degrees.   Much of this also involved a better spin number in addition to 1 more degree of launch. I knew I needed a change, but it never ceases to amaze me of the value of a proper fitting.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How do you like your GT driver?</title><link>https://www.titleist.in.th/teamtitleist/thread/363244?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Tue, 03 Jun 2025 19:09:26 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">9ab519fc-5311-4952-85cd-0a0ceffb73fb:73e39d20-436c-44f4-a27a-d5bb7d7d1bd7</guid><dc:creator>Eric Blinkhorn</dc:creator><description>I got fitted for GT3 10 degree Driver in March with Graphite Design Tour AD IZ-6 Shaft.... If you hit a ball that hits near the top of the face and the paint edge - it can chip that paint.  Not a sky ball but one that hits that edge - the dimples have left marks for me.  I bought another head because of that and sold my first one to a friend.  This is a flaw IMO&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The paint seems to have too much thickness allowing it to be chipped or crack with an impact at the top - where if it were thinner, it would be less susceptible to issues with a high hit.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
The thing that this head shines on is off center hits not being that different from a center strike.&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How do you like your GT driver?</title><link>https://www.titleist.in.th/teamtitleist/thread/360222?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Fri, 21 Mar 2025 01:04:34 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">9ab519fc-5311-4952-85cd-0a0ceffb73fb:d99e4d15-305d-4100-81fb-0d7ddbb6553f</guid><dc:creator>pulplvr</dc:creator><description>Went to my local Titleist fitter today to check out the GT1 line. Now to wait so I can compare actual usage performance over fitting performance.&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How do you like your GT driver?</title><link>https://www.titleist.in.th/teamtitleist/thread/360134?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Thu, 20 Mar 2025 06:29:06 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">9ab519fc-5311-4952-85cd-0a0ceffb73fb:e0ae0940-d479-42d1-ad46-24c577f18805</guid><dc:creator>Phil C</dc:creator><description>I’ve ALWAYS had issues with driving accuracy but hit a good distance for my build. Two years ago I got fit for the tsr2 and saw an improvement in accuracy but I was still prone to the odd wild one. So two weeks ago I went to see my coach to try the png G driver series - they’d come runner up vs the tsr2 for distance in my previous fitting and were slightly more accurate for me.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Long story short, I hated the pings. They felt dead and I resigned myself to keeping the tsr2 as nothing else worked. Until coach asked if I’d consider another titleist. First he sticks the gt2 in my hands and to me (I know it’s just me) it looked offset and I hated it compared to the tsr2.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Next he hands me a GT1 and tells me to just hit it. I’m not a slow swinger so slightly perplexed at hitting “the old mans club” I start hitting it. What a club, unbeknownst to me if you stick a heavier weight in the back and use a normal shaft it becomes an moi monster. I couldn’t do anything but hit it straight and I gained ten yards….&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Fast forward to this week and I’ve collected my gt1. On the course I hit some obnoxiously poor tee shots with it that still landed in the fairway or semi rough. This club is massively forgiving but it doesn’t feel like titleist is shouting about its benefits with the heavier set-up. I haven’t loved a driver or driven the ball this accurately since my r7 superquad. You’ll have to pry it out my cold dead hands as I can’t see how I can find a more accurate driver.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Anyone with driving issues I highly suggest trying the GT1 with the heavier set-up. Beat the pings hands down for me and looks far nicer to boot.&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: How do you like your GT driver?</title><link>https://www.titleist.in.th/teamtitleist/thread/359529?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Wed, 05 Mar 2025 01:58:26 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">9ab519fc-5311-4952-85cd-0a0ceffb73fb:98c5ba1c-3c17-4214-9345-42a3ecf1ec0e</guid><dc:creator>Brandon P</dc:creator><description>I did my fitting back in August with a Titleist fitter.
